码迷,mamicode.com
首页 > 系统相关 > 详细

shell中常用括号用法汇总 linux课程学习

时间:2018-01-16 18:38:14      阅读:236      评论:0      收藏:0      [点我收藏+]

标签:条件测试   san   大括号   ali   反引号   变量   含义   linux   替换   

Linux中小括号()和大括号{}都是对其中的一串命令进行执行,但有一定的区别,其具体含义如下:

( ):括号内的命令会在一个子shell中执行

(( )):将括号内的数值进行比较与运算

$( ):命令替换,等同于反引号` `

$(( )):整数运算

{ }:对括号内的一组字符进行操作

${ }:变量的引用

[ ]:条件测试

[[ ]]:支持正则表达式的条件测试

$[ ]:整数运算

以上是对Linux中各种括号的具体解释,对于经常分不清的人来说,可以比照学习,相信,多用几次也都分清楚了!


shell中常用括号用法汇总 linux课程学习

标签:条件测试   san   大括号   ali   反引号   变量   含义   linux   替换   

原文地址:http://blog.51cto.com/12306609/2061536

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!